Ei Jhuma Jhuma Golapi Belare is a song about a woman who is dancing joyfully in the rain-drenched forest. Her colorful sari is soaked from the rain as she dances under the trees and listens to the sounds of the forest during the monsoon downpour. She dances with abandon, enjoying the rain and celebrating the beauty and renewal brought by the monsoon season.
